本文目录导读:
随着互联网的飞速发展,越来越多的用户渴望拥有一个个性化的导航网站,以方便快捷地访问各类资源,本文将深入剖析自定义导航网站源码,为您揭示其核心架构与实战技巧,助您轻松打造属于自己的导航网站。
自定义导航网站概述
自定义导航网站是指用户可以根据自己的需求,自定义添加、删除或修改网站链接,实现个性化导航的目的,这类网站具有以下特点:
1、个性化:用户可根据自身喜好定制导航内容,提高使用体验;
图片来源于网络,如有侵权联系删除
2、简洁:界面简洁,易于操作;
3、高效:快速访问所需资源,提高工作效率;
4、安全:用户数据加密存储,保障隐私安全。
自定义导航网站源码分析
1、技术选型
自定义导航网站源码通常采用以下技术:
(1)前端:HTML、CSS、JavaScript等;
(2)后端:PHP、Python、Java等;
(3)数据库:MySQL、MongoDB等。
2、源码结构
自定义导航网站源码通常包括以下部分:
(1)前端页面:负责展示导航界面,包括网站列表、搜索框等;
(2)后端逻辑:负责处理用户请求,如添加、删除、修改网站链接等;
图片来源于网络,如有侵权联系删除
(3)数据库操作:负责存储网站链接信息,如网站名称、链接地址等。
3、关键代码解析
(1)前端页面
前端页面主要采用HTML、CSS和JavaScript等技术实现,以下是一个简单的HTML页面示例:
<!DOCTYPE html> <html> <head> <title>自定义导航网站</title> <link rel="stylesheet" type="text/css" href="style.css"> </head> <body> <div class="search"> <input type="text" placeholder="搜索网站"> <button>搜索</button> </div> <div class="site-list"> <!-- 网站列表 --> </div> <script src="script.js"></script> </body> </html>
(2)后端逻辑
后端逻辑主要采用PHP、Python、Java等技术实现,以下是一个简单的PHP示例:
<?php // 添加网站链接 if (isset($_POST['add_site'])) { $site_name = $_POST['site_name']; $site_url = $_POST['site_url']; // 将网站链接信息存储到数据库 // ... } // 删除网站链接 if (isset($_POST['delete_site'])) { $site_id = $_POST['site_id']; // 从数据库中删除网站链接 // ... } // 修改网站链接 if (isset($_POST['update_site'])) { $site_id = $_POST['site_id']; $site_name = $_POST['site_name']; $site_url = $_POST['site_url']; // 更新数据库中网站链接信息 // ... } ?>
(3)数据库操作
数据库操作主要涉及增删改查(CRUD)操作,以下是一个简单的MySQL示例:
-- 创建网站链接表 CREATE TABLEsite_links
(id
int(11) NOT NULL AUTO_INCREMENT,name
varchar(100) NOT NULL,url
varchar(200) NOT NULL, PRIMARY KEY (id
) ); -- 添加网站链接 INSERT INTOsite_links
(name
,url
) VALUES ('网站名称', '链接地址'); -- 删除网站链接 DELETE FROMsite_links
WHEREid
= 1; -- 修改网站链接 UPDATEsite_links
SETname
= '新网站名称',url
= '新链接地址' WHEREid
= 1;
实战技巧
1、前端优化
(1)使用响应式设计,确保网站在不同设备上都能正常显示;
(2)优化图片加载速度,提高用户体验;
(3)使用前端框架(如Bootstrap、Vue.js等)简化开发过程。
图片来源于网络,如有侵权联系删除
2、后端优化
(1)使用缓存技术,提高网站访问速度;
(2)对数据库进行优化,提高查询效率;
(3)使用异步请求,提高用户体验。
3、安全性
(1)对用户数据进行加密存储,保障隐私安全;
(2)对敏感操作进行权限验证,防止恶意操作;
(3)使用HTTPS协议,确保数据传输安全。
通过深入剖析自定义导航网站源码,我们了解到其核心架构与实战技巧,掌握这些知识,您将能够轻松打造一个个性化、高效、安全的导航网站,在实际开发过程中,还需不断优化与完善,以满足用户需求,祝您在导航网站开发领域取得丰硕成果!
标签: #自定义导航网站 源码
评论列表